University of Bridgeport - Housing & Campus Life
Housing and Policies
Guaranteed On-Campus Housing For All Undergraduates
75% of first-year students live in college housing
45% of all undergraduates live in college housing
Housing options:
Coed Housing
Wellness housing (alcohol/drug/smoke-free)
Deadline for housing deposit: 01-MAY
Amount of housing deposit: $200
Housing deposit is not refunded if student does not enroll.
First-time first-year students allowed to have car
